Well let's not forget that The Witcher splits all Vampires into two categories:High and Lower Vampires.High Vampires can shape shift at will in order to integrate better with their prey so we'll see them most likely both as NPCs and regular mobs (like the House of the Queen of the Night in TW1):

The Lower Vampires like the Fleder inhabit graveyards and caves and since they're not as intelligent as their higher cousins and can't shape shift our interactions with them will probably be limited to chopping their head off.Still,as I've said in my previous post I really enjoy how Mr.Sapkowski and CDPR have portrayed them so I will like to see more Vampires in TW3.


Going back to what Gwyn said about wanting to see more types of Werewolves in The Witcher,personally,I don't think that we'll get that in TW3.As opposed to Vampires,which ar portrayed in various ways throughout Eastern and Central Europe,Werewolves have a pretty consistent image in all of the different cultures that mention them in their myths and since CDPR always stay true to the source material I don't think we'll be seeing different variations of werewolves.Other WERE folk on the other hand...

Sidenote:
-The Transylvanian/Romanian word for Werewolf is "Vârcolac",in Bulgarian it's "Vǎrkolak",in Lithuanian "Vilkolakis" and in serbian "Vukodlak".The greeks have "Vrykolakas" but oddly enough it doesn't mean Werewolf,it means Vampire
